The squonk is a mythological creature that supposedly lives in the marshes of Pennsylvania. Legends say that the squonk is a very ugly creature that spends most of its time alone and weeping because it knows how ugly it is.
Some say the squonk tries very hard to avoid water, because it doesn't want to see its own reflection.
There was once a comical book of folklore that claimed a hunter once captured a live squonk in a bag, and tried to bring it to a zoo... but before he got very far, the squonk melted away into a pool of its own tears.
The song "Squonk" by Genesis is simply a retelling of the legend. A squonk is captured by a hunter, and placed in a bag, where it dissolves into nothing but tears.
The exasperated hunter notes that the squonk race is surely doomed. -
This is an anti hunting song, per mike rutherford.
